KEVIN PORTER

Ice Hockey
Kolarik
Ice Hockey
Porter

Left Wing

Shoots: Left

Ht/Wt: 5-11/180

Drafted: Phoenix, 4th round, 2004

First point:Assist vs. Boston

Scouting Report

Strengths: Porter is a great two-way player. In the
offensive zone he has great vision and should find himself among
the assist leaders.

Weaknesses: Porter can get a little too fancy with the
puck. He needs to keep it simple.

Potential: Porter has been paired early with Milan Gajic,
which should present him a ton of assist opportunities.

Coaches Corner: “Porter is solid, very dependable.
We feel comfortable with him on the ice in any situation.”
— Associate Head Coach Mel Pearson

 

CHAD KOLARIK

Right Wing

Shoots: Right

Ht/Wt: 5-11/175

Drafted: Phoenix, 7th round, 2004

First point:Goal vs. Boston

Scouting Report

Strengths: Kolarik is a big-time goal scorer. Along with
his touch around the net, he has the ability to set up his fair
share of goals, too.

Weaknesses: His defense is a potential liability. He
needs to improve his play away from the puck

Potential: Kolarik should find himself near the Michigan
scoring leaders. Look for him to embarrass a few goalies.

Coaches corner: “Chad is energetic, skillful and
dynamic — the things we had hoped he’d bring to our
team.” — Pearson
